SYNCRONYS FILLS STRATEGIC EXECUTIVE POSITION February 18, 1998 08:06 AM Culver City, CA--(BUSINESS WIRE)--February 18, 1998--Syncronys Softcorp SYCR today announced the appointment of Nancy Mohler to Vice President, Marketing & Product Management. Ms. Mohler reports to Daniel G. Taylor, Executive Vice President, Marketing, and is responsible for product management and coordinating integrated product launches into the domestic retail channel as well as Syncronys' newly created OEM, Direct, On-line and International channels. Nancy Mohler joins Syncronys from Quarterdeck Corporation QDEK , where she was Senior Director, Product Management. In that capacity she was responsible for managing Quarterdeck's top performing products, including CleanSweep, Procomm and Partition-it. Ms. Mohler, who holds an MBA in marketing from the University of Missouri-Columbia, brings to Syncronys more than 15 years of high-tech marketing experience, after having established a strong foundation in marketing packaged goods. Ms. Mohler's broad-based product management and marketing experience includes corporate and consulting positions with Lucasfilm, Atari, Ashton-Tate and The Seven-Up Company.
